What's Happening?
Aldi is introducing a new promotional campaign offering free 'Aldi Blind Boxes' to customers, tapping into the popular trend of mystery box shopping. From June 22 to June 25, Aldi will release a limited number of themed grocery boxes each day, available
on a first-come, first-served basis through their website. The boxes, which include themes like protein, fiber, and snacks, aim to provide customers with a surprise assortment of Aldi's popular products. This initiative is designed to engage customers who are looking for value and the excitement of discovering new products.
